A steel and brass firegrate
In the George III style, circa 1880
The serpentine railed basket with urn finials, stamped with serial number 1738, to the back of the flanges, sides and backplate
28½in. (72.3cm.) high, 28½in (72.3cm.) wide, 17¼in. (43.7cm.) deep
A Victorian brass fender, the pierced frieze flanking a writhen plinth -- 47¼in. (120cm.) wide; and a set of late Victorian or Edwardian brass fire tools, with baluster knopped shafts and flared shovel -- 24¼in. (62.2cm.) high (5)
